About Us
Alpine MDF Industries is a leading wood processing facility based in Wangaratta, North East Victoria. We manufacture and distribute MDF products both nationally and internationally, providing stable employment for over 140 local workers.
Our primary focus is the production of Medium Density Fibreboard (MDF), widely used in the construction and related industries. In addition to our core manufacturing operations, we operate an
on-site re-manufacturing facility, enhancing raw MDF into high-quality building products. These include pre-painted skirting boards, architraves, door and window components, and decorative wall lining panels.
About the role
We are currently seeking a full-time 1st Year Apprentice Wood Machinist to join our team.
This is an excellent opportunity to begin a rewarding career in manufacturing while completing a nationally recognised trade qualification. You will receive both on-site and off-site training, developing the skills required to set up, operate, and maintain moulding and sawing machinery used in the production of MDF mouldings, VJ lining boards, and other moulded products.
This position operates on a 3-week rotating roster across day, afternoon and night shifts, Monday to Friday.
Night 11:00pm – 7:06am Start 11pm Sunday, Finish 7:06am Friday
Afternoon 3pm-11:06pm Start 3pm Monday, Finish 11:06pm Friday
Day 7am-3:06pm Start 7am Monday, Finish 3:06pm Friday
